Third-quarter market share of the South Korean mobile phone market Samsung leads by a wide margin with 84%.
In the third quarter, Samsung dominates the South Korean mobile phone market with a significant 84% market share.
【Mobile China News】Recently, the latest data released by market research firm Counterpoint Research showed that Samsung smartphones accounted for a staggering 84% of the total smartphone sales in South Korea in the third quarter of this year, which can be said to be far ahead.
Samsung Z Flip5
The data shows that the total smartphone sales in South Korea in the third quarter of this year decreased by more than 10% compared to the same period last year, reaching around 3.4 million units. In terms of manufacturers, Samsung Electronics accounted for 84%, with its market share holding steady, still maintaining a comfortable lead. Samsung Electronics launched the flagship foldable phones, Galaxy Z Flip5 and Z Fold5, in the third quarter, with pre-sales reaching 1.02 million units. The second-ranked manufacturer is another international giant, Apple, with a market share of 15%, an increase of 2 percentage points compared to the same period last year. Therefore, it can be said that only Samsung and Apple occupied 99% of the market share in the South Korean new phone market in the third quarter, basically monopolizing the South Korean smartphone market.

Unlike the Chinese smartphone market with numerous brands, the South Korean smartphone market is almost monopolized by a few brands. Previously, apart from Samsung and Apple, LG was also an important participant in the South Korean smartphone market. However, with LG’s announcement of quitting the mobile business in 2021, its previous market share in the Korean market has been mostly divided between Samsung and Apple. Judging from the sales proportion of the South Korean smartphone market announced in the third quarter, the South Korean smartphone market has become a “two-person” world dominated by Samsung and Apple.
